.research-section{background:url(/areas-bg.jpg) 50%/cover no-repeat;justify-content:center;align-items:center;height:100vh;display:flex;position:relative}.underlineOurServices{background-color:#fff;align-self:center;width:10%;height:4px;margin-top:10px;margin-left:auto;margin-right:auto;margin-bottom:30px!important}.content{z-index:2;text-align:center;color:#fff;max-width:1200px;padding:20px;position:relative}.content h1{color:#fff;margin-bottom:1rem;font-size:2em;font-weight:600}.stats-container{color:#fff;flex-wrap:wrap;justify-content:space-around;gap:20px;display:flex}.stat-item{color:#fff;text-align:center;flex:calc(33.33% - 40px);margin:.5em 0;padding:10px;position:relative}.stat-item.half-width{flex:calc(50% - 40px)}.stat-item.half-width:nth-child(4):after{content:"";background-color:#fff;width:2px;height:5em;position:absolute;top:50%;right:-10px;transform:translateY(-50%)}.stat-item h2{color:#fff;text-align:center;margin:0;font-size:3rem;font-weight:600}.stat-item p{text-align:center;color:#fff;margin-top:10px;font-size:1.2rem}@media (max-width:768px){.stats-container{color:#fff;flex-wrap:wrap;justify-content:space-around;gap:3px;display:flex}.content{z-index:2;text-align:center;color:#fff;height:90vh;padding:20px;position:relative}.research-section{background:url(/areas-bg.jpg) 50%/cover no-repeat;justify-content:center;align-items:center;height:90vh;display:flex;position:relative}.stats-container{flex-direction:column;align-items:center}.stat-item{flex:100%}.content h1{font-size:2rem}.stat-item h2{text-align:left;font-size:2.5rem}.stat-item p{font-size:1rem}.stat-item:after{height:20px}}@media (max-width:480px){.stat-item{color:#fff;text-align:center;flex:calc(33.33% - 40px);margin:.2em 0;padding:10px;position:relative}.research-section{background:url(/areas-bg.jpg) 50%/cover no-repeat;justify-content:center;align-items:center;height:110vh;display:flex;position:relative}.stats-container{color:#fff;flex-flow:column wrap;justify-content:space-around;align-items:center;gap:3px;display:flex}.content h1{font-size:1.5rem;font-weight:600}.stat-item h2{text-align:left;font-size:2rem;font-weight:600}.stat-item p{font-size:.9rem;font-weight:400}.stat-item:after{height:30px}}
